The Holocene is the name given to the recent 10,000 to 12,000 years of the Earth’s history — the time since the end of the last major glacial advance. Since then, there have been small-scale climate shifts — notably the Little Ice Age between about 1200 and 1700 A.D. The chief climate trend of the Holocene can be regarded as a warming period of the previous Ice Age that began in the Pleistocene (the period beginning about two-and-a-half million years ago and lasting until the beginning of the Holocene).

The geological time scale (GTS), as defined by international convention depicts the long spans of time from the beginning of the Earth to the present. Its divisions chronicle some definitive events of Earth history. (In the graphic: Ga means “billion years ago”; Ma, “million years ago”.) Earth formed around 4.54 billion years ago, approximately one-third the age of the universe, by accretion from the solar nebula.
Volcanic outgassing probably created the primordial atmosphere and then the ocean, but the early atmosphere contained almost no oxygen. Over time, the Earth cooled, causing the formation of a solid crust, and allowing liquid water on the surface.
The Last Time CO2 Was This High, Humans Didn’t Exist
The last time there was this much carbon dioxide (CO2) in the Earth’s atmosphere, modern humans didn’t exist. Mega-toothed sharks prowled the oceans. The world’s seas were up to 100 feet higher than they are today. The global average surface temperature was up to 11°F warmer than it is now. …
Scientists have found that CO2 levels have not been as high as they are now for at least the past 10 to 15 million years.

“That was a time when global temperatures were substantially warmer than today. There was very little ice around anywhere on the planet. And so sea level was considerably higher — around 100 feet higher — than it is today,” said Pennsylvania State University climate scientist Michael Mann, in an email conversation. “It is for this reason that some climate scientists, like James Hansen, have argued that even current-day CO2 levels are too high.
There is the possibility that we’ve already breached the threshold of truly dangerous human influence on our climate and planet.”…

New research may resolve a climate ‘conundrum’ across the history of human civilization
Earth’s surface temperature warmed rapidly at the end of the last ice age. After about 17,000 to 7,000 years ago, the rate of warming slowed as the climate stabilized. However, it didn’t reverse into a cooling trend, because atmospheric greenhouse gas levels were rising.
Then, of course, came the Industrial Revolution, ONLY, 200 years ago. … Over the past 7,000 years, when human civilization began to develop and thrive, Earth’s temperatures and climate were quite stable. The temperature change during the past 7,000 years was about 0.5°C. Humans have caused that much warming in just the past 25 years.
If not for the human influence, the climate would continue the stable conditions of the past 7,000 years. Humans are in the process of destabilizing the climate. We are causing global warming at a rate 20 times faster than Earth’s fastest natural climate change. That’s why climate scientists are so concerned, and why the Paris agreement is so important.

Why guidance on biogenic emissions would be timely
Investor interest in fossil fuel alternatives has significantly increased in recent years, making the need for guidance on claims of climate benefits particularly acute.
In a recent Wall Street Journal article, Derek Horstmeyer, a professor of finance at George Mason University, analyzed inflows of money into “sustainable” or Environmental, Social and Governance (ESG) U.S. stock exchange traded funds and mutual funds. He found that in December 2016, one month after President Trump’s election,
“a staggering $2.1 billion flowed into U.S. equity sustainable funds…The ‘Trump
bump’ (which was the largest single monthly increase into the sustainable
investing class ever) was 170% larger than the next-largest one-month inflow.
And the growth has continued. Since the election, $8.1 billion has flowed into
these funds, a 13.1% jump from the assets under management on the eve of the
2016 presidential election – by far the greatest percentage inflow into any class or
style of fund (e.g., value, growth, small-cap funds) since the election.”
Horstmeyer reported that environmentally-focused funds account for “just about half of all U.S.
equity sustainable focused funds.”
What you need to know now about Low Carbon Fuel Standards and verifications
Understanding the changes to California’s Low Carbon Fuel Standards (LCFS) verification process is important for all ethanol and biodiesel producers. This is important even if you do not currently sell fuels in California. Several other regions around the world are in various stages of planning to incorporate carbon impact scoring into their transportation fuels legislation. As a result, awareness of the LCFS procedures required to comply with carbon-impact verifications will help you stay competitive. This will be true anywhere in the global marketplace, as you set long-range plans for your facility.
As of now (effective 1 January 2019), the new GREET 3.0 model applies to all new pathway applications. Current GREET 2.0 pathways are valid until 31 December 2020. They must be transitioned by this time to registration under the 3.0 model. All 2019 validations (for pathways under both models) are still performed directly by the California Air Resources Board (CARB). They use their previously established validation procedures, but this is about to change.

Jul 25, 2012 – Sponsored by the U.S. Department of Energy’s Office of Energy Efficiency and Renewable Energy (EERE), Argonne has developed a full life-cycle model called GREET (Greenhouse gases, Regulated Emissions, and Energy use in Transportation). It allows researchers and analysts to evaluate various vehicle and fuel combinations on a full fuel-cycle/vehicle-cycle basis. The first version of GREET was released in 1996. Since then, Argonne has continued to update and expand the model. The most recent GREET versions are the GREET 1 2012 version for fuel-cycle analysis and GREET 2.7 version for vehicle-cycle analysis.
